IIS安装发布使用详解.docx
《IIS安装发布使用详解.docx》由会员分享,可在线阅读,更多相关《IIS安装发布使用详解.docx(28页珍藏版)》请在冰豆网上搜索。
IIS安装发布使用详解
IIS安装、发布、使用详解
IIS运行环境:
硬件:
最低配置:
486/50以上,16M内存,50M硬盘空间
建议配置:
P90,32-64M内存,200M硬盘空间
软件:
NTServer4.0,ServicePack3,IE浏览器(4.0以上版本),支持TCP/IP协议
或者:
Windows2000,IE,支持TCP/IP协议
IIS安装:
如果您的计算机没有安装IIS,可以按照下面的步骤进行安装:
1、您先要准备好,Windows2000/XP的安装光盘,然后“开始”->“设置”->“控制面板”->“添加/删除程序”,如图1所示。
图1
2、“添加/删除windows组件”,如图1所示。
图2
3、选中“Internet信息服务(IIS)”,然后单击“下一步”,出现如图3。
图3
4、在出现图4的对话框,单击“完成”即可。
图4
IIS发布WEB站点:
利用IIS发布站点,可以按照下面的步骤进行:
1、您先要从“开始”->“设置”->“控制面板”->“管理工具”,如图5所示。
图5
2、打开“Internet服务管理器”,如图6、7所示。
图6
图7
3、在这里,您可以删除或停止默认WEB站点,您要建立一个新的WEB站点来进行发布。
在图7中的右边,单击右键,选择“新建”->“Web站点”。
在出现图8的对话框,单击“下一步”即可。
图8
4、在图9的框中,填写对您的站点的说明,单击“下一步”即可。
图9
5、出现图10,单击“下一步”即可。
图10
6、出现图11,在填空中输入您存放网页文件的地方,如:
d:
\web。
或者单击“浏览”,出现图12,进行选择确定。
然后单击“下一步”
图11
图12
7、出现图13,单击“下一步”即可。
图13
8、出现图14,单击“完成”即可。
图14
9、出现图15,表示完成建立了站点,并且运行正常。
这里是。
图15
10、将您使用FrontPage或者DreamWeaver等工具制作的网页、图片拷贝到D:
\web目录下,即可完成你的个人网站、照片等的发布。
您可以打开IE浏览器,在地址栏输入http:
//localhost/进行预览,查看效果。
如果您启动了动态域名服务的域名为,那么您可以直接在地址栏输入
IIS提供的基本服务:
WWW服务:
支持最新的超文本传输协议(HTTP)1.1标准,运行速度更快,安全性更高,还可以提供虚拟主机服务。
WWW服务是指在网上发布可以通过浏览器观看的用HTML标识语言编写的图形化页面的服务。
IIS5.0允许用户设定数目不限的虚拟Web站点。
FTP服务:
支持文件传输协议(FTP)。
主要用于网上的文件传输。
IIS5.0允许用户设定数目不限的虚拟FTP站点,但是每一个虚拟FTP站点都必须拥有一个唯一的IP地址。
IIS5.0不支持通过主机名区分不同的虚拟FTP站点。
SMTP服务:
支持简单邮件传输协议(SMTP)。
IIS5.0允许基于Web的应用程序传送和接收信息。
启动SMTP服务需要使用NT操作系统的NTFS文件系统。
除上述服务之外,IIS5.0还可以提供NNTPService等服务。
本篇将主要讨论其中最重要的WWW服务,读者在真正熟悉WWW服务之后,其它类型的服务也可做到触类旁通。
IIS的设置(注:
文章中“客户”指Web站点的访问者,“用户”指IIS5.0的使用者)
打开Microsoft管理控制台之后,单击InternetInformationServer文件夹,出现用户的电脑标识。
打开后选中“默认的Web站点”,右击点属性,出现IIS的配置界面(注:
IIS中的服务配置都是通过类似的属性界面实现,用户可以尝试一下。
此外,IIS中的属性具有继承性,子级目录自然继承上级目录的相同属性)。
Web站点:
Web站点标识:
描述--用户指定该站点的名称。
IP地址--用户分配给该站点的IP地址(动态域名的用户,您可以使用默认的IP地址,选中"全部未分配",即可)。
在高级对话框中还可以进一步的设定该站点的IP地址,TCP端口号以及主机名称等(注:
同一台Web服务器中,具有不同IP地址或不同主机名的不同站点称为虚拟主机)。
TCP端口--缺省值为80,用户可以根据自己的需要进行改动。
SSL端口--指定使用安全套接字层(SSL)的端口。
连接:
无限--不限制同时连接站点的用户数量。
限制到--读者可以根据需要限定在同一时刻连接站点的用户数量。
连接超时--如果访问用户在指定的时间范围内没有发出新的访问请求,Web服务器自动中断与该用户的连接。
启用日志:
在提供给用户的日志格式选择中,NCSA为较通用格式,W3C为扩展格式,ODBC为数据库日志格式。
在属性对话框中,可以进一步的设定日志记录的时间间隔单位,以及日志文件的存放位置。
操作员
通过该项可以在NT用户帐号中指定对站点拥有操作权的用户帐号(注:
操作员帐号不一定必须是WindowsNT管理员组的成员,操作员只具有有限的站点管理权限)。
性能:
性能调整--可以根据站点的具体情况设定每天访问站点的人数。
该项可以相应的调整Web站点所占用的系统内存的大小。
带宽限制--启用带宽限制将会限制Web站点所能够使用的带宽。
连接配置--“保留HTTP连接”允许客户维持与服务器已经打开的连接,而不要求对客户的每个新请求都启用新的连接。
ISAPI配置器
设置用于处理HTTP请求过程中的对事件作出响应的程序。
主目录:
源内容--设置存储站点内容的目录或计算机。
许可访问--设置客户对站点内容的访问权限。
只有支持HTTP1.1协议标准的具有“放置”功能的浏览器才能执行写操作。
内容控制--日志访问将在日志文件中记录对站点目录的访问;允许浏览目录可以在当客户没有指定具体的访问页面同时站点也没有设定默认页面时自动生成一个目录内容页面;索引此目录将指定目录加入Web站点的全文索引(注:
需安装MicrosoftIndexServer);FrontPageWeb将在Web站点中创建一个FrontPageWeb目录。
应用程序设置--在分开的窗口内运行:
选定该选项将使应用程序独立于Web服务器进程单独运行。
运行独立的应用程序可以在当应用程序出现错误时,使其他应用程序(包括Web服务器)免受影响。
许可:
无--不允许在服务器端运行任何程序或脚本。
脚本--允许运行映射到脚本引擎的应用程序而不必拥有“执行”权限。
执行(包括脚本)--允许运行脚本程序,dll以及exe程序。
文档标签
启用默认文档:
设置当访问客户没有具体指定浏览页面时显示的默认页面。
启动文档脚注:
可以自动为网站的页面加上脚注,可以用于添加站点的LOGO等标
目录安全性标签
匿名访问和安全控制(单击编辑进入配置):
允许匿名访问--指定一个NT用户帐号,使所有网站的访问者使用该帐号以匿名方式登录。
基本验证--验证来访客户的用户名和密码(注:
此项在不使用匿名登录方式或已经在NTFS文件系统中设置访问控制时有效)。
WindowsNT挑战响应--只有在禁用匿名方式或在NTFS文件系统中设置访问控制时有效,不支持挑战响应方式的浏览器将被禁止访问。
安全通讯:
使用密钥管理器建立认证请求。
IP地址和域名控制:
允许访问将会向除用户指定的地址之外的所有客户授予访问权;禁止访问将禁止除用户指定地址之外的所有客户的访问。
HTTP标题
允许内容过期:
设置客户浏览器根据指定的过期时间决定是否从客户本机缓存读取数据或连接网站请求新数据。
自定义HTTP标题:
用户自己编写的发送给客户浏览器的HTTP标题。
内容分级:
在HTTP标题中加入内容级别,使客户可以在浏览器端选择过滤不接受的内容。
MIME(多用途Internet邮件扩展)映射:
设定由Web服务器传送给浏览器的文件类型。
自定义错
用户自己设定在出错时返还到浏览器的错误信息。
以上,是IIS的基本配置,读者只要在实践中多加练习,并结合NT用户帐号管理以及NTFS文件系统的学习,就可以为自己建立起一个功能完善,性能稳定的Web浏览器。
Win2000/WinXP如何安装IIS,Win98如何安装PWS图/文:
自由勇点击:
MT-8000最后更新2003-10-02
相对于PHP,安装IIS或者PWS是很容易的。
IIS(WinNT平台下)和PWS(Win9X平台下)属同一事物,是ASP的开发平台、运行后台,也是服务器的运行软件。
关于IIS的安装,在ASP教程的前部分有简要介绍。
首先,强烈推荐Windows2000服务器版。
在安装系统的时候,默认的设置中,Win2000服务器版已经安装了IIS。
最近推出的Win2003服务器版,没有想像中的那么好,因为服务器追求的是速度。
在我用过的5种系统中:
Win98、Win2000专业版、Win2000服务器版、WinXP、Win2003服务器版,Win2000服务器版运行速度是最快的,IIS响应时间非常短;WinXP最慢。
安装IIS或PWS之后,最重要的就是要设置虚拟目录。
如果没有虚拟目录,网页将无法访问。
Win2000专业版安装IIS很顺利,WinXP用户安装IIS比较麻烦。
本文将分5个部分来详细介绍:
1.Win2000如何安装IIS?
2.WinXP如何安装IIS?
3.IIS如何设置虚拟目录、如何卸载IIS?
4.如何设置默认文档?
5.Win98如何安装PWS,PWS如何设置虚拟目录?
注意:
如果IIS在使用当中遇到问题,请点击这里查看专题。
其实最好的解决办法就是修复或者重装系统,因为系统的dll动态链接文件,或其它驱动程序,往往会被破坏。
1.Win2000如何安装IIS?
Win2000的IIS是5.0版,是ASP的开发平台。
安装方法是,插入Win2000或WinXp安装盘,点击“开始→设置→控制面板→添加/删除程序→添加/删除Windows组件”,然后出现下图,把第一项IIS打上勾就可以了:
图1
然后有2次提示插入光盘:
这时一定要找到I386这个目录,并且这两次都需要你重新查找路径,一路确定就安装完毕了﹗
2.WinXP如何安装IIS?
WinXP安装IIS比较麻烦,据我本人见过的有2种专业版本,一种是可以像Windows2000一样正常的安装IIS;另一种,在添加/删除Windows组件是看不到IIS安装项,它的详细步骤如下:
1)首先,请点击这里从本网站下载驱动程序,236K:
[Download]
2)解压缩后,可以得到两个文件。
假设你的XP系统安装在E:
\Windows目录。
3)把iis.inf复制到E:
\Windows\inf目录。
4)把iis.dll复制到E:
\Windows\system32\setup目录。
5)然后点击这里下载ADMXPROX.DL_文件:
[Download],把它存在任意的路径,只要安装时能找到它。
6)然后插上WinXP的安装盘,就可以像Win2000一样安装了,步骤如上。
·如果安装以后,打开Internet服务管理器看到的是空空如也,无法连接计算机的话,你只好换一张XP的安装盘了,重新安装XP系统。
3.如何使用IIS?
(设置虚拟目录)
你需要建立虚拟目录,特别注意:
Win2000专业版和服务器版的设置有所不同。
这里仅以最常见的专业版为例:
比如我的计算机名叫“zic”,我的D盘有“我的作品”这个文件夹,给它命名为zp,设虚拟目录后就可用http:
//zic/zp来访问它。
如果不知道你的计算机名,可以在桌面上“我的电脑”点右键→属性,计算机名也可以用本地IP127.0.0.1或localhost代替。
设虚拟目录的方法是:
打开控制面板→管理工具,选择“Internet服务管理器”,展开后在“默认Web站点”(或默认网站)点鼠标右键,选择“新建→虚拟目录”,别名写zp,目录找到D:
\我的作品,把“执行、写入、浏览”等都打上勾。
确定后就OK了﹗关键步骤如下图:
注意这里──────→
关于中文,要注意的是,在资源管理器里,你的主页根目录可以用中文(例如“D:
\我的作品”),但是根目录的内容或者往下一级,也就是你的主页文件夹、文件名,都不可以用中文,否则无法显示。
然后你就可以用http:
//zic/zp或者http:
//127.0.0.1/zp或者http:
//localhost/zp来访问你的主页了。
下面我们开始进行测试:
在“D:
\我的作品”下建立一个webshu.txt文件,然后改名为webshu.asp,写入一段程序。
如下图:
例如我的计算机名是zic,用这三种方式在本地访问这个文件,运行结果如:
127.0.0.1/zp/webshu.asp
zic/zp/webshu.asp
localhost/zp/webshu.asp
4.如何设置默认文档?
建议你把文件夹的默认文档设为index.htm,以后浏览这个文件夹就方便了。
例如D:
\我的作品\index.htm这个文件只要用http:
//zic/zp这可访问,当然http:
//zic/zp/index.htm也同样。
方法是:
建立虚拟目录后,展开“默认Web站点”,可看到刚建立的zp,在zp上点鼠标右键→属性,选择“文档”,让“启用默认文档”打上勾,把它原有的3项删除,你添加上index.htm就可以了。
·关于默认文档,你可以添加多个默认文档,越靠上的越优先。
例如:
index.htm
index.asp
说明:
当找到不到index.htm的时候,它就会找index.asp文件。
·如何卸载IIS
打开“开始→设置→控制面板→添加/删除程序→添加/删除Windows组件”,如图1所示,把第一项IIS上的勾去掉,点下一步完成卸载。
5.Win98如何安装PWS,如何设置虚拟目录?
1.找到“Win98完全版”安装光盘,光盘有add-ons\pws文件夹。
在pws文件夹里,双击setup.exe,安装完毕。
2.然后找出C:
\WINDOWS\SYSTEM\inetsrv\pws.exe,打开了“个人Web管理器”。
3.在主屏的“发布”显示pws当前状态。
如果已经停止,你就点击“启动”。
4.需要设虚拟目录。
方法是,在个人Web管理器点击“高级”,然后选“添加”,别名很重要,例如起别名为spa。
“浏览”找到你的主页目录所在文件夹,例如D:
\我的作品\我的网页。
5.把读取、执行、脚本都打上勾,确定。
6.把“启用默认文档”和“允许浏览目录”都打上勾。
默认文档写为index.htm,index.asp
7.至此调试完毕。
然后,在IE输入http:
//127.0.0.1/spa就可以浏览你的ASP网页了。